Cabin Demolition in Katy, TX
Cabin demolition services involve the safe and efficient removal of wooden structures, typically small homes or cabins, from residential properties. This process includes tearing down the existing building, managing debris removal, and preparing the site for future use or development. Projects often requested by property owners include clearing out old cabins prior to new construction, removing seasonal or unused structures, or demolishing structures that are no longer safe or functional.
Before requesting cabin demolition, property owners should understand the scope of work involved, such as site preparation, debris disposal, and potential permits needed for the project. Clarifying the size and condition of the structure, as well as any surrounding features that may be affected, helps ensure a smooth process. It's also useful to consider how the removal might impact nearby property features and to inquire about the necessary steps for proper site cleanup and restoration afterward.

Cabin Demolition Questions
What types of cabins are suitable for demolition? Any wooden or small structure cabin can be demolished, regardless of size or location on the property.
Is a permit required for cabin demolition? Permit requirements depend on local regulations; it’s advisable to check with local authorities before starting.
What should be done to prepare a cabin for demolition? Clearing the area around the cabin and removing any personal belongings helps facilitate a smooth demolition process.
What happens to the materials after demolition? Debris is typically removed and disposed of according to local waste management guidelines.
